Description
Photograph of a man performing a lab test at the International Electronic Research Corp, ca.1940. A man in a lab coat stands left of a table full of devices. He puts his left hand on a machine, as he writes something onto a thick wad of paper.

Description
The more than 3,600 unique photographs of this collection document the Chamber's promotional efforts during the city's early years. In addition to stock photographs, there are pictures of the elaborate booths and displays that the Chamber prepared for use at state fairs and international trade shows. The photographic collection contains images showing the growth of important municipal enterprises, such as ground transportation systems, aviation, and shipping. In addition there are about 1,000 lantern slides in this collection -- not yet fully digitized.
